emerit in Spotlight at World Skills 2009

September 14 2009

From September 1st to 6th, CTHRC and TIAPEI represented emerit at World Skills 2009 in Calgary, Alberta. Over 900 individuals competed simultaneously in 45 skill categories during the four days of intense competition at Stampede Park. Hailed as the pinnacle of global skills, trades, and technologies competition, this biennial event promotes excellence and global competency industry standards. Competitions range from robotics to web design, welding to cooking, and auto-body repair to restaurant services. This year’s event hosted over 120,000 visitors and delegates from around the world, including industry leaders, educators, government officials, and educational experts. Overall, Team Canada competitors won eight medals, including a gold in Restaurant Service for Pierre-Luc Coté from Saint-Apollinaire, Quebec.

The emerit interactive booth garnered widespread interest with World Skill visitors who wanted to learn the skill of opening and pouring a bottle of wine as defined in the emerit Wine Server National Occupational Standards. emerit gained the attention of Global News – Calgary, who featured TIAPEI’s emerit and Marketing Coordinator Rod Clark demonstrating this skill on the September 4th morning news.
